Protective Effect of Honokiol on Cadmium-induced Renal Injury in Chickens

Abstract: 【Objective】 This study was aimed to study the protective effect of honokiol (HNK) on renal injury in animals exposed to cadmium (Cd).【Method】 Forty eight Sanhuang chickens with similar body weight (61.05 g±2.00 g) and good health conditions were randomly divided into four groups,each group had three replicates and each replicate had four chickens.The chickens in control group was fed with basal diet,in Cd group, 70 mg/kg cadmium chloride were added in the basal diet,in HNK group, 400 mg/kg HNK were added in the basal diet, and in the combined treatment group (HNK+Cd group), 70 mg/kg cadmium chloride and 400 mg/kg HNK were added in the basal diet.The feeding period was 30 days.【Result】 Compared with control group,the content of cadmium in the kidney,the serum uric acid (UA) and creatinine (CREA) contents were extremely significantly increased (P<0.01),the lumen of the renal crypt was enlarged and the number of apoptotic cells was increased,the contents of selenium,iron,and manganese in kidney were extremely significantly decreased (P<0.01),and the contents of zinc and copper in kidney were extremely significantly increased(P<0.01) in Cd group.The contents of zinc and iron in kidney were extremely significant or significantly increased (P<0.01 or P<0.05),and there were no significant differences in the cadmium,selenium,copper,and manganese contents of kidney,and serum UA and CREA contents in HNK group (P>0.05).Compared with Cd group,for the chickens in HNK+Cd group,the contents of cadmium,copper in kidney and serum UA were significantly decreased (P<0.05),the content of CREA was decreased,but the difference was not significant (P>0.05),the contents of selenium,zinc,iron,and manganese in kidney were significantly increased (P<0.05),and the renal tubular cell injury was alleviated and the number of apoptotic cells was also reduced.【Conclusion】 HNK could reduce the accumulation of cadmium in kidney,reduce the number of apoptotic cells in kidney tissue,alleviate renal injury,improve the metabolism disorder of trace elements in chicken,and enhance the constitution of chicken.

Key words: honokiol(HNK); cadmium; chicken; renal injury; apoptosis; trace element
